You could always make full-screen art and use wide-screen aspect ratio... then use this to your advantage.
There's not a whole lot cooler than a really dynamic novel game which moves the art around a lot. If you draw an image too big for the screen, you can pan around at runtime O.O
At least, that's what the most popular commercial games do~~~

I've been pondering the screen size too and the question I'm asking myself right now is whether it's better to scale up or scale down the screen sizes. Seeing as how Ren'Py can now resize the game screen to the actual screen size, I'm wondering if it's better to make a bigger game screen size like 1680 x 945 and have a higher quality picture for those who can see it rather than working with a 1024 x 600 and have the image be artificially resized and therefore losing the quality of the image. The only draw back to using a bigger game screen size is that the initial window of the game is too big for the screen before you put it into fullscreen mode.
